Ms. Z. has a 5-year old child who was full-term at birth. Since that time she has had an infant who was stillborn at 38 weeks and a spontaneous abortion that occurred at 13 weeks. She is currently 7 months pregnant.
Ms. Z
G4T2P0A1L1
Child term at birth goes to G, T, L
Stillborn at 38 weeks goes 1 to G, 1 to T and 1 to A
Abortion BEFORE age of viability (20-36), 1 to G, 1 to A
Ms. M. has had 3 pregnancies and is pregnant again. (At home, she has full-term twins and a child born at 36 weeks.) She also has had a fetus that spontaneously aborted at 10 weeks.
Ms. M
G4T2P1A1L3
36 weeks is preterm! After 36 weeks it term

4 ts with PPH
Tone
Tissue
Trauma
Thrombin
